Vehicle used by candidate torched

POKHARA, May 7: A vehicle used by Nepali Congress candidate for ward chief from Machhapuchchhre rural municipality-2, Gunjaman Gurung, for the election purpose was set on fire on Saturday night.

An unidentified group torched the parked vehicle (Ga 1 Ja 6445) at Sardikhola, said Vice-President of NC, Kaski, Hari Acharya. The vehicle was completely damaged in the incident. 

Meanwhile, issuing a press release, NC, Kaski, condemned the incident and demanded action against the guilty immediately. 


The press release issued by district party president, Krishna KC, also warned not to carry out such activities in days ahead. RSS
